Output 65d6816b8a8d70097155662c4defea5702995de77fd4fa3cc5aeed6f5d0b947e:96

value
165127
script pubkey
OP_0 OP_PUSHBYTES_20 30f5ab9200be815c6ddeb017c779ea89d53fff3a
address
bc1qxr66hysqh6q4cmw7kqtuw702382nlle6ganafe
transaction
65d6816b8a8d70097155662c4defea5702995de77fd4fa3cc5aeed6f5d0b947e
confirmations
64370
spent
true